I recently replaced my laptops DVD-ROM drive and it would not read the disc i inserted. I had to troubleshoot in order to fix the problem and fortunately i found a solution.
First of all i tried to enter in safe mode using the F12 or F8 function before the windows logo appears while booting the computer. In the safe mode the DVD-ROM was working just fine. It would read cd or dvd disk. that was the first step. After some more research and googeling i found on the microsoft's web site the solution... see steps bellow
- Click start
- Run and type devmgmt.msc as shown bellow
- The device manager window will open. Now expand the IDE ATA/ATAPI controllers
- Double click on the Secondary IDE Channel or the one that is appropriate for your case (e.g you may have more IDE channels).
- Chooe tab Advanced Settings and change the Transfer Mode field, in my case the correct one was PIO Only value.
